Editing an x axis

How do we change our x axis labels from numbers to the month written out Screenshot 2024-04-03 at 2.09.44 PM.png

Use the Month Name field in the axis instead of the number. If you don't have that field you will need to create it either through DAX or Power Query. Refer to this link to check both options.
